- Google MCP Toolbox · Reported multiple vulnerabilities across Google MCP Toolbox, including CVE-2026-14537, a Critical 9.8 authorization failure, together with CVE-2026-11719, CVE-2026-14538, CVE-2026-14539, CVE-2026-14541, and CVE-2026-16481, covering authentication, authorization, isolation, and trust-boundary failures across MCP execution paths
- Linux kernel · Discovered and reported three kernel vulnerabilities, including CVE-2026-68326, CVE-2026-68402, and CVE-2026-64339, covering wireless and USB attack surfaces with fixes integrated into upstream development
- libvirt / Red Hat · Discovered CVE-2026-63622, a filesystem trust-boundary flaw allowing a compromised
swtpmservice context to influence host-side ownership changes, and CVE-2026-63623, a storage-volume permission window exposing guest disk contents during clone and convert operations - Docker MCP Gateway · Reported four vulnerabilities in Docker's MCP Gateway, including CVE-2026-76092, a Critical 9.2 authentication failure exposing proxied MCP tools without authentication, and CVE-2026-76094, a High 7.7 image signature-verification weakness
- Apple platform · Credited by Apple for CVE-2026-43806 in macOS
mDNSResponder - GitHub MCP Server · Reported CVE-2026-48529, an authorization and cross-user client isolation flaw in GitHub's official MCP Server
- MCP ecosystem · Cross-project security research spanning Google, Docker, IBM, HashiCorp, GitHub, Contentful, official Model Context Protocol SDKs, dbt Labs, MISP, and Rapid7, studying authentication, authorization, isolation, SSRF, filesystem, resource-lifecycle, and trust-boundary failures across LLM tooling
